Concrete Issues & Repair Insights in Uxbridge

Seasonal temperature swings between summer heat and hard winter freezes stress concrete surfaces and the ground supporting them. Sandy loam pockets mixed with clay create uneven drainage, so one end of a driveway can settle while the other stays put. Driveway panels that lift and crack along expansion joints are the most common call, followed closely by front walkways that tilt toward the house. Mudjacking is still common for thicker slabs like stoops and garage floors, while foam leveling tends to be preferred for walkways and patios where a faster cure time matters. Concrete leveling demand tends to spike before home sales, when inspectors flag uneven slabs as safety or drainage issues.

Frost penetrates Massachusetts soil two to four feet deep in a typical winter, and that repeated pressure is the primary driver of concrete settlement throughout Uxbridge. When the subgrade expands from freezing and heaves slab edges upward, then thaws and contracts in spring, the concrete does not always return to its original position. Gaps open beneath the slab, rain and snowmelt move into those gaps, and the process repeats each season until visible settlement and trip hazards develop.

Replacing a settled slab is expensive and disruptive. Concrete leveling achieves the same result at a fraction of the cost by lifting the existing slab back to grade and filling the voids that caused it to drop. Contractors in the Uxbridge area use two methods. Polyurethane foam injection drills small holes through the slab, injects a fast-expanding foam that raises the concrete as it cures, then patches the holes clean. Most jobs take one to three hours, and the surface handles foot traffic immediately and vehicle traffic the same day. Mudjacking pumps a cement-based slurry under the slab through larger holes. It costs less per square foot than foam, but requires 24 to 48 hours to cure before vehicles can use the surface.

Most residential concrete leveling jobs in Uxbridge fall between $600 and $2,500. Polyurethane foam injection is priced at $6 to $18 per square foot; mudjacking is priced at $4 to $8 per square foot. Small repair projects, such as a sunken garage step or two sidewalk panels, typically cost $300 to $500. Larger projects with full driveway coverage or significant settlement cost toward the higher end. Work in Massachusetts is most readily scheduled between late spring and early fall; frost conditions affect mudjacking schedules more than foam injection.

How Much Does Concrete Repair Cost in Uxbridge?

What to expect when budgeting for concrete repair in Uxbridge, MA.

Concrete Repair in Uxbridge typically costs $3 to $15 per square foot, or $300 to $5,000 for a typical residential project. The exact price depends on the slab size, the amount of settlement, and how easy it is to access the area.

Concrete Repair estimate range in Uxbridge: roughly $3 to $15 per sq ft, or about $300 to $5,000 for many residential jobs.

These are general estimates, not fixed quotes for Uxbridge. Final pricing depends on slab size, settlement depth, access, and method selection.

In Uxbridge, a two-panel sidewalk fix might cost $400 to $800. A full driveway with moderate settlement across several sections can run $1,500 to $3,000.

Polyurethane foam injection tends to cost a bit more than traditional mudjacking, but it cures faster and puts less weight on the soil underneath. Many contractors have a minimum charge of $300 to $500, so very small jobs may cost more per square foot than you'd expect.

Why Concrete Repair Matters in Uxbridge

Local conditions that contribute to concrete settlement in Uxbridge, MA.

Freeze-thaw cycles through fall and winter are the primary driver of concrete settlement in the Northeast. Many homeowners notice new damage each spring after frost heaves shift the soil beneath their slabs. In Uxbridge, many homeowners schedule inspections before peak season to get faster turnaround times. Massachusetts sits in the northeast region, so weather patterns can influence project timing.

Concrete that has settled unevenly puts stress on the slab itself. Slabs are designed to sit on a uniform surface, and when part of the support underneath shifts, cracking follows. In Uxbridge, this progression can turn a simple leveling job into a more expensive repair if left alone. Massachusetts homeowners who catch settlement early typically avoid the need for full slab replacement.

What to Look for in a Concrete Repair Contractor

Verify Credentials

Before hiring any concrete repair contractor in Uxbridge, confirm they carry general liability insurance and meet local licensing requirements. Ask for proof. Reputable contractors won't hesitate to show it.

Understand What You're Paying For

Request an itemized estimate that breaks down labor, materials, and any additional charges like mobilization or patching. This makes it easier to compare bids from different contractors.

Ask About Previous Work

Ask if the contractor has photos of recent concrete repair projects similar to yours. Before-and-after images give you a realistic sense of what to expect. References from Uxbridge homeowners are even better.

Warranty Details

Not all warranties are equal. Some cover only the leveling work, while others include the injected material and soil stabilization. Ask what happens if the slab settles again within the warranty period.
